#ifdef HAVE_CONFIG_H
#include <config.h>
#endif

#include <QKeyEvent>

#include "TextEdit.h"

namespace QtHandles
{

void
TextEdit::focusOutEvent (QFocusEvent* xevent)
{
  QTextEdit::focusOutEvent (xevent);

  emit editingFinished ();
}

void
TextEdit::keyPressEvent (QKeyEvent* xevent)
{
  QTextEdit::keyPressEvent (xevent);

  if ((xevent->key () == Qt::Key_Return
       || xevent->key () == Qt::Key_Enter)
      && xevent->modifiers () == Qt::ControlModifier)
    emit returnPressed ();
}

}; // namespace QtHandles
